Vantis letter bomb suspect named

Vantis letter bomb suspect named

Police reveal that arrested suspect had been under surveillance for several days

The letter-bomb suspect arrested yesterday has been named as 26-year-old
school caretaker, Miles Cooper.

Cooper is reported was under surveillance for several days before police
swooped on his home in Cherry Hinton near Cambridge at 3am yesterday morning.

He is being held at an undisclosed location for questioning in connection
with the seven letter bombs, sent to companies with ties to road enforcement
authorities.

One of the bombs exploded at tax and accounting firm
Vantis, used as the business address by a
client that involved in speed camera work.

Police began an intense search at Cooper’s home and have also searched the
home of his father in March, Cambridgeshire.

The
Times
reported that police moved computer equipment and are expected to
spend several more days at the three-roomed home where Cooper lives with his
mother and sister.

‘We had a significant breakthrough in the investigation at the weekend and
have had a suspect under surveillance. We believe this is a very significant
development,’ a police source said.

The extremist that sent the bombs also targeted the Driver & Vehicle
Licensing Agency in Swansea and the offices of a company that runs London’s
congestion-charging system.

The bombs were home-made pyrotechnic devices containing glass, with at least
one posted from the Cambridge area.
